For an orthodontist whose primary output is clear-aligner models, Lumina has a particularly compelling workflow. It is designed around orthodontics, provides direct Invisalign connectivity, and Align specifically highlights its full-jaw accuracy, speed, ergonomics and photorealistic scans.
Align's published testing using the ADA/ANSI 132 full-jaw model found Lumina had significantly lower total error than the tested TRIOS 5, CS3800, Medit i700 and Alliedstar scanners. That is manufacturer-sponsored testing, so I wouldn't treat it as definitive independent evidence, but it's still relevant.
Why I'd buy it for an Invisalign practice:
The major downside is ecosystem lock-in and cost. If you're sending most cases to Invisalign anyway, however, I'd consider that a feature rather than a bug.
The TRIOS 6 is arguably the more interesting choice for a digitally sophisticated orthodontic practice that wants to work with multiple aligner companies, labs, and in-house workflows. It is explicitly indicated for orthodontics and has very high-resolution/hyperspectral imaging.
But there's an important catch: as of 3Shape's current documentation, TRIOS 6 does not integrate with Invisalign; 3Shape says TRIOS 3 is currently the TRIOS scanner that can send scans for Invisalign.
So I would not buy a TRIOS 6 assuming you'll get the same Invisalign workflow as an iTero.
The i900 is the one I'd demo if you care about excellent scans without paying primarily for an ecosystem. It's lightweight, fast, and supports open file workflows. Independent clinical research has also found the i900 and TRIOS 5 to have excellent accuracy/precision in certain applications.
For an orthodontist who routinely sends STL files to different aligner manufacturers, Medit becomes very attractive.

One thing I'd emphasize: don't choose based on raw accuracy alone. For aligner production, once you're in the range of the good modern scanners, the clinically important differences are often full-arch stitching, capturing gingival margins, scan speed, software cleanup, bite registration, export format, aligner-provider integration, and how much staff time the workflow consumes.

For clear aligner models specifically, I wouldn't pay a huge premium merely to chase the last fraction of a millimeter of scanner accuracy. Modern flagship IOS systems are all capable of producing clinically useful aligner models; workflow, scan consistency, software integration, exportability, support, and total cost of ownership are likely to matter more in your day-to-day practice.
One other consideration: operator technique and scanning protocol matter enormously for full-arch orthodontic scans. I'd put a lot of weight on a live demo where you scan several challenging patients—especially crowded arches, deep palates, saliva, and partially erupted teeth—rather than relying solely on manufacturer accuracy numbers.

For an orthodontist doing a large percentage of Invisalign, Lumina is difficult to beat because the scan → Invisalign submission → ClinCheck workflow is exceptionally integrated. It also produces photorealistic 3D models, has a much smaller wand than older iTero generations, and is specifically positioned by Align for orthodontics.
Align reports superior full-jaw accuracy in its own testing against several competing scanners, although I'd treat manufacturer-sponsored accuracy comparisons cautiously.
Why I'd buy it: If your primary business is Invisalign, workflow integration and staff efficiency matter more than squeezing out the last fraction of a millimeter of scan accuracy.
This is arguably the best all-around scanner for a digitally sophisticated orthodontic practice. TRIOS 6 is the current flagship and offers wireless scanning, ScanAssist, very high-resolution imaging, and an open ecosystem with STL/PLY/DCM export. It's indicated for orthodontics and integrates with numerous clear-aligner and digital-lab workflows.
One major wrinkle: TRIOS 6 currently does not integrate directly with Invisalign. 3Shape explicitly says that TRIOS 6 scans aren't accepted through its Invisalign integration; TRIOS 3 is currently the TRIOS model with that integration.
That's a surprisingly important consideration if Invisalign is your dominant aligner platform.

And I wouldn't choose based on advertised accuracy alone. For orthodontics, I'd put the decision roughly:
workflow/integration > full-arch accuracy > scanning speed > ergonomics > file openness > price.
One particularly important point: full-arch accuracy and scan stitching matter more for aligner models than impressive single-tooth accuracy numbers. You're creating an entire upper/lower digital model and registering the occlusion, so I'd have each vendor scan several of your actual orthodontic patients—including crowded arches, partially erupted teeth, saliva, and difficult distal molars—before buying.
